This role requires strong analytical and data handling skills; enthusiasm and an ability to prioritise and organise a busy workload, for yourself and others.



The ability to organise contractors and 3rd party resources, organise planned works programmes is essential; and the passion to lead on operational delivery of the Asset Management Strategy and Energy Performance Strategy ensuring it delivers within a framework of efficiency and value for money.



The council has demanding targets to meet in reducing carbon emissions and improving energy performance in our housing stock and other buildings. To do this we require accurate survey data and well managed performance data. We are required to share this data with regulatory bodies and be confident that it is right first time. This is where our team comes in…



You have a good understanding around net-zero carbon emissions, and energy efficiency. You want to be an expert.



You can coordinate the workload of a team of surveyors – ensuring their survey forms are uploaded ready for them to operate and accurate, clear, reliable data is gathered and downloaded. You will lead on reporting out the findings from this data – applying intelligence and analysing the outcomes to ensure we can target our maintenance investment in the right places at the right time.



This work is the basis of our long-term investment strategy for property – and the solid foundations are crucial, so quality is key.



You will:



Lead on the collection of robust stock data to ensure planned programmes of work are delivered against the objectives of the Asset Management Strategy and Energy Performance Strategy
Train and develop the colleagues collecting this data, including those appointed through external contracts
Prepare reports and statistical information using a variety of formats and media to provide analysis on energy performance and asset management performance to inform asset sustainability.
Use this complex data to maximize investment funding opportunities with a focus on attracting grant and other income.
Report on this data in support of the Councils obligations to the Regulator of Social Housing, the Building Safety Regulator, MHCLG and other key statutory bodies.
